Output 7dabe2afbee7e3a66e54e131cfe2959c3162242a7363e815b1524d4d3cfae77e:0

value
26761400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b255de8311a83a13f62da04a619089f2f93c8f2a OP_EQUAL
address
3Hwy4z6qGHxUmuBJjFnbumXiAfyc5EH45X
transaction
7dabe2afbee7e3a66e54e131cfe2959c3162242a7363e815b1524d4d3cfae77e
spent
true